Output af0b4e109d150fa992eabec0494aae1fdde3383177945c3657fea23e6d1d0160:78

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 06af1545db0f31dcfa4d917dca589d442fe30c16b4bf8be74a4e42d01c06cde7
address
tb1pq6h323wmpucae7jdj97u5kyagsh7xrqkkjlche62fepdq8qxehnsc8awcg
transaction
af0b4e109d150fa992eabec0494aae1fdde3383177945c3657fea23e6d1d0160
confirmations
8903
spent
true